Cost of Drinking Calculator

Drinking can be an expensive habit. You may not notice a dollar here or two dollars there, but think about how much you spend on alcohol each week. It can add up.

One drink is one 12-ounce bottle or can of beer or wine cooler; one 5-ounce glass of wine; or 1.5 ounces of 80-proof distilled spirits. The amount of alcohol in any size drink will vary based on the amount of alcohol in the drink. For example, the amount of alcohol in a 12-ounce beer can vary from 4% to 6% or more.

A 750 ml bottle of wine contains about 5 5-ounce glasses. A liter bottle contains about 6 glasses.

A fifth (1/5 of a gallon) of distilled spirits contains almost 17 1.5-ounce shots.
